Hello.

I’m having a problem where a majority of the time when I call an extension with no answer, it won’t give an prompt saying “ To page press 3”. Even if I press #3 without the prompt, it will say " sorry that is an invalid entry"

However other times on the exact same situation it will give me the option to page the user by pressing #3. When I press 3, it will work perfectly(but only when they prompt tells me that I can press 3)

This is the worst problem when it sometimes works and sometimes does not work.

Standard Eclass block have both No answer and Busy with all “Y” next to all the different options including the “Overhead page” option.

I would say that 6 out of 7 times it does not work.

Has anyone experienced this strange problem?

Any ideas on something that works sometimes but most of the time does not work?

Do you think corrupt customer database? Should I make a new EClass, Set download to yes and reset VM to rewrite database,etc...? Please let me know what I should try to fix this.


Update:

I have just found out by looking at the port activity that the calls with the option to page are being transfered as " NT" however the calls that do not have the option to page are being transfered as " NS" I think this is why the calls are giving different options. They must be pointing to different areas.

How to I change the area that NT and NS transfer to?

UPDATE:

I have reset my VM card and telling my system to use " DOWNLOAD: YES" which I overwrites some of the information and default a lot of values.

So far, it seem to be working and the outbound calls coming into the system seem to all be coded as a NT call instead of a NS call.


NT(No answer from trunk) vs NS(No answer from a station) I think.

So far so good.

First,an internal user has the option to page the party if there is no answer.When the voicemail answers,press the release key,get new dialtone and press a page button.

Even if the SVMi could page the internal no answer calls I don't think there is a way to "pick" up the call.
